2 Page 2 FOOD PANTRY MINISTRY Over the course of the last several months we have talked about the resources that we have here and need here at Bethany Lutheran Church. We now have a mission statement approved by this congregation that reminds us that: Bethany Lutheran Church works to be a growing, living, faith community focusing on outreach. Following the example of Christ, we will share love, grace and hope and commit the resources of time, talents and wealth to our church, our village and all of God s creation. There is no greater example of this mission than our Food Pantry. We have individuals who have given of their time to this enterprise for many years or in many ways, but at times it can be an overwhelming task. So we have created a plan for staffing the Food Pantry that make it manageable for those involved but allow us to continue this program that so many people depend on in our community. As part of this plan, Lori Olkiewicz is willing to remain as the Director of the Food Pantry. We thank her for her service as well as Bill, Karen, and Jodi, who continue to volunteer their time. However, we have several positions that need to be filled. This division of labor will allow you to give just a few hours a month to help keep the Food Pantry running. In many cases this time is very flexible. The division of labor and job descriptions are found below. DIRECTOR Occasional meetings with township staff and members of United Methodist Church pantry to review procedures and clients. Pick up previous month s receipts from Chipains at the beginning of the month. Review them and pull and copy those receipts that have unauthorized purchases. Fill out a warning letter, keep record of these warnings and give warnings to Marge to review with pantry client. Responsible for denying pantry access to clients for stealing, inappropriate behaviors, etc. Determine when overflow items should be sent to Morningstar Mission in Joliet (when items would not be taken by clients before its expiration date). LEAD SHOPPER Get a list of needed items from the pantry volunteers. Purchase groceries when necessary. This may be twice a month in the summer and once in other months. Oversee assistant shopper volunteers (which may be local students) Ideally, 2-3 people should go at one time as it will fill more than one cart. We may ask Chipains to put the groceries on our monthly bill. Also purchase and pick up paper grocery bags from Chipains (usually every 2 months). (Need 2 volunteer assistants) LEAD PR PERSON Need an individual to continually promote the pantry. Write letters (can be a form letter) to businesses and organizations about the needs of the pantry. Give short speeches about the pantry (history, number of clients, all privately funded) to organizations when necessary. Coordinate and schedule special deliveries when they come during off hours. Arrange with other volunteers to accept deliveries during off hours. (Must have key to accept delivery.) LEAD VOLUNTEER ORGANIZER (We can never have too many volunteers) Determine when groceries need to be purchased. Receive s and calls to schedule new volunteers. Explain duties to new volunteers. Asking for 1 ½ hours per month to check expiration dates, inventory and stock shelves on pantry days (Tuesday, Wednesday and Thursday) from 8:30AM to 10 AM. Keep track of when volunteers are scheduled (can be as simple as using a calendar). (Need multiple regular volunteers and need extra help when large deliveries come in.) (Volunteers must be 18. If younger, two adults must be present.) ***Additional volunteers are needed the first day of the month. *** CLEANING Come in once a month and dust shelves.

6 JUNE/JULY 2013 Pastoral Call Timeline Report The original timeline was an optimistic one -- a best case scenario. Not surprisingly, some things have taken longer than expected for one reason or another. At this point, we are approximately six weeks behind the best case scenario timeline. Not to worry--progress is being made! CALENDAR June 25th, 7PM Call Committee Meeting July 17th, 7:30 PM Church Council Meeting Completed: Council/Call Committee Retreat Call Committee Focus Group Meetings 2012 ELCA Parochial Report Filed Financial Resources Assessment Mission Site Profile In Progress: Mission Site Profile Approval by Council Membership Update Website Development Reminder--As noted in the original timeline, there is generally a 2 month period from the time the Mission Site Profile (the congregation s paperwork) is filed with the synod to the time that pastoral candidates are interviewed. That means that the Call Committee will not begin interviews until late summer or early fall. In the meantime, keep praying for Bethany s new pastor!
